From the Ground Up: Wanda Gray Elementary School addition

Posted online

Owner/developer: Springfield R-XII School District

General contractor: Crossland Construction Inc. (Columbus, Kan.)

Architect: Butler, Rosenbury & Partners Inc.

Engineers: Anderson Engineering Inc., civil; Butler, Rosenbury & Partners, structural; Malone Finkle Eckhardt & Collins Inc., mechanical, electrical and plumbing

Size: 18,125 square feet

Estimated cost: $4.8 million

Lender: None

Estimated completion date: November

Project description: This is the first addition since 1988 to the 48,516-square-foot Wanda Gray Elementary School, which was built in 1986. Current work includes a new gymnasium, kindergarten classrooms, a renovated and expanded library and renovated offices. Project funding is available through the district’s $96.5 million bond initiative approved by voters in April 2006, according to Scott Wendt, director of capital construction for Springfield R-XII School District.
